Cellulose and fiberglass are not the same thing; they are different materials with distinct properties and uses. Cellulose is a natural polymer derived from plant fibers, commonly used in insulation, paper products, and biodegradable materials. In contrast, fiberglass is made from fine strands of glass and is primarily used for its strength and durability in applications like insulation, boat building, and construction materials. While both can be used for insulation, their compositions and characteristics differ significantly.

Is glassfiber the same as fiberglass?

Yes, fiberglass and glass fiber refer to the same material. Fiberglass is a composite material made from fine fibers of glass, which are woven or layered and often combined with a resin to create a strong, lightweight structure. It is commonly used in various applications, including insulation, boat building, and automotive parts. While "glass fiber" typically describes the raw material itself, "fiberglass" often refers to the finished product or composite.

Is fibreglass stronger than steel?

No, steel is typically stronger than fiberglass. Steel has a higher tensile strength, meaning it can withstand a greater amount of force before bending or breaking compared to fiberglass. Fiberglass is more lightweight and corrosion-resistant, making it suitable for certain applications where weight and corrosion are concerns.
